深入了解 Shadowsocks 连接数的相关知识

目录

  1. 什么是 Shadowsocks 连接数
  2. Shadowsocks 连接数的重要性
  3. 如何设置 Shadowsocks 连接数
  4. Shadowsocks 连接数的最佳实践
  5. 常见问题解答

什么是 Shadowsocks 连接数

Shadowsocks 是一种加密代理协议,广泛用于突破网络审查和访问被封锁的网站。其中,Shadowsocks 连接数指的是同一时间内,可以通过 Shadowsocks 代理建立的最大连接数。这是一个重要的参数,因为它决定了 Shadowsocks 服务器可以同时支持的最大用户数量。

Shadowsocks 连接数的重要性

  • 提高服务质量: 合理设置 Shadowsocks 连接数可以确保每个用户都能获得稳定、流畅的网络体验,避免因连接数不足而导致的网速下降或连接中断。
  • 提升安全性: 适当限制连接数可以降低服务器资源被滥用的风险,有效防范来自恶意用户的攻击。
  • 优化资源利用: 合理设置连接数可以充分利用服务器的网络和计算资源,提高整体运行效率。

如何设置 Shadowsocks 连接数

Shadowsocks 连接数的设置通常在服务器端进行。具体步骤如下:

  1. 登录 Shadowsocks 服务器。
  2. 编辑 Shadowsocks 配置文件,找到 server_portpassword 等参数。
  3. 在配置文件中添加 max_connections 参数,并设置合适的值。
  4. 保存配置文件,重启 Shadowsocks 服务。

需要注意的是,max_connections 的值应根据服务器的硬件配置和预计用户数合理设置,既不能过小影响用户体验,也不能过大浪费服务器资源。

Shadowsocks 连接数的最佳实践

  • 定期监控连接数: 密切关注 Shadowsocks 服务的连接数使用情况,适时调整 max_connections 参数。
  • 合理分配资源: 如果服务器配置较高,可以考虑部署多个 Shadowsocks 实例,分散用户连接。
  • 使用负载均衡: 对于大规模用户,可以采用负载均衡技术,将用户连接分散到多个 Shadowsocks 服务器上。
  • 优化网络环境: 确保服务器网络环境稳定,带宽充足,以支持更多的并发连接。

常见问题解答

Q1: Shadowsocks 连接数是如何计算的?

A: Shadowsocks 连接数指的是同一时间内,通过 Shadowsocks 代理建立的最大连接数。每个用户的一个网络请求都会占用一个连接,因此连接数反映了服务器当前的负载情况。

Q2: 如何查看 Shadowsocks 的当前连接数?

A: 可以通过登录 Shadowsocks 服务器,查看日志文件或使用相关监控工具来获取当前的连接数信息。常用的工具包括 netstatss 等。

Q3: 设置 Shadowsocks 连接数时应该注意哪些?

A: 设置 Shadowsocks 连接数时,应该综合考虑服务器硬件配置、预计用户数、网络环境等因素,合理设置 max_connections 参数,既不能过小影响用户体验,也不能过大浪费服务器资源。

Q4: 如果 Shadowsocks 连接数达到上限会发生什么?

A: 如果 Shadowsocks 连接数达到上限,后续的连接请求将被拒绝,用户可能会遇到无法连接或连接失败的问题。这时需要适当调整 max_connections 参数或者部署更多的 Shadowsocks 服务器。

Q5: 如何优化 Shadowsocks 的连接数性能?

A: 优化 Shadowsocks 连接数性能的措施包括:定期监控连接数使用情况、合理分配服务器资源、使用负载均衡技术、优化网络环境等。通过这些措施可以确保 Shadowsocks 服务能够为更多用户提供稳定、流畅的网络体验。

正文完